Distance from Pointe-à-Pitre to Kingston

There are several ways to calculate the distance from Pointe-à-Pitre to Kingston. Here are two standard methods:

Vincenty's formula (applied above)
  • 2118.417 miles
  • 3409.262 kilometers
  • 1840.854 nautical miles

Vincenty's form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points on the earth's surface using an ellipsoidal model of the planet.

Haversine formula
  • 2122.875 miles
  • 3416.436 kilometers
  • 1844.728 nautical miles

The haversine form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points assuming a spherical earth (great-circle distance – the shortest distance between two points).
